Description
Helminthosphaeriaceae is a family of ascomycetous fungi within the Sordariomycetes class. While many species are known as saprotrophs, several act as opportunistic pathogens that can colonize and damage plant tissues, particularly in forest trees and various woody agricultural crops. They represent a specialized group of fungi that thrive by breaking down complex plant cell structures.
The host range of these fungi includes various deciduous trees, fruit-bearing bushes, and some herbaceous perennial plants. They often target weakened or stressed plants, utilizing environmental openings or mechanical wounds to penetrate internal vascular tissues. Once inside, they can disrupt nutrient transport and weaken the overall structural integrity of the plant host.
Signs of infection typically appear as localized dark lesions, necrosis of the bark, or blackened surface spots. A key diagnostic feature is the presence of small, dot-like fruiting bodies (perithecia) that emerge through the surface of the infected tissue. Over time, these lesions can expand, causing cracking and structural degradation of the stems or branches.
The development of these fungi is highly dependent on environmental conditions, particularly high humidity and moderate temperatures. Moisture allows for the rapid germination of spores and the establishment of mycelial growth. Spread occurs primarily via wind-dispersed spores and water splash during heavy rains, making closely spaced or dense canopy environments particularly susceptible to outbreaks.
Management of Helminthosphaeriaceae requires a combination of cultural and chemical strategies. Cultural practices are paramount: pruning and removing diseased branches, improving plant spacing for better air circulation, and clearing debris from the growing area. In severe cases, preventive applications of fungicides during the dormant season and early growth stages are recommended to limit spore germination and further spread.
